Many attics end up as forgotten storage, filled with items we rarely use. However, with some thoughtful planning, these spaces can become both attractive and practical closet areas.

Utilize Angled Ceilings

Custom shelving maximizes every inch under angled ceilings.

Make the most of those challenging sloped ceilings by installing bespoke shelving units that are a perfect fit. I’ve discovered that these areas are ideal for storing folded clothing or shoes.
